FFmpeg versions 4.4 through 8.1.2 contain a double-free vulnerability in the NVIDIA NVDEC hardware decoder within libavcodec/nvdec.c that allows attackers to trigger memory corruption by supplying a crafted video file. When no decoder surfaces remain, the ff_nvdec_start_frame_sep_ref error path frees memory via nvdec_fdd_priv_free while the calling layer subsequently frees the same frame description data, resulting in a double-free of the underlying decoder context in any FFmpeg-based application using NVDEC hardware-accelerated decoding.
